Latin America Telecommunication Infrastructure Market Overview:

The Latin America telecommunication infrastructure market size reached USD 35.8 Billion in 2024. Looking forward, IMARC Group expects the market to reach USD 51.3 Billion by 2033, exhibiting a growth rate (CAGR) of 3.75% during 2025-2033. The market is driven by the growing reliance on 5G networks, as they run on higher frequency bands, resulting in shorter range and more densely distributed base stations, along with the increasing telecom infrastructure investments in Brazil due to its enormous user base.

Latin America Telecommunication Infrastructure Market Trends:

5G Deployment

According to the data published on the official website of 5G Americas, around nine million new 5G connections added to reach a total of 48 million 5G connections in the Latin America region during the first quarter of 2024. To enable the faster data throughput and lower latency of 5G technology, new infrastructure, such as more cell towers, tiny cells, and fiber optic cables, are required. These enhancements are resulting in considerable investments in the region's telecom infrastructure. 5G runs on higher frequency bands, resulting in shorter range and more densely distributed base stations. This demands considerable infrastructure construction to maintain continuous coverage, particularly in metropolitan areas. 5G networks necessitate a strong fiber optic backbone for data transfer between base stations and core networks. As a result, 5G deployment is driving investments in fiber optic network expansion throughout the region to ensure that the infrastructure can meet the needs of 5G services. 5G's huge data capacity and ultra-low latency make it perfect for serving Internet of Things (IoT) devices. Healthcare, industry, agriculture, and logistics are all adopting IoT technologies, creating demand for 5G infrastructure to serve these applications. The push for smart city development in major Latin American cities relies significantly on 5G technology for smart traffic systems, energy management, surveillance, and other connected services. The development of modern telecommunication infrastructure is critical to the success of these undertakings.

Thriving Telecom industry

Brazil is the largest telecom market in Latin America, with millions of consumers reliant on mobile and fixed-line services. Because of the size of Brazil's telecom business, changes and investments in the country frequently have a regional impact, affecting trends, innovations, and infrastructure upgrades in adjacent nations. Brazil is an important destination for telecom infrastructure investment due to its enormous user base and increasing demand for connection, acting as a stimulus for regional infrastructure expansion. Brazil's telecom operators are increasingly entering into infrastructure-sharing agreements to cut costs and hasten network expansion. These models may inspire similar techniques throughout Latin America, resulting in speedier and more cost-effective infrastructure deployment across the continent. Global telecom companies consider Brazil as a gateway to the rest of Latin America, and they frequently use the country as a platform for regional alliances, infrastructure development, and technology deployments. As Brazil continues to improve its telecom infrastructure, it will inspire other Latin American countries to meet comparable rising demand. The IMARC Group’s report shows that the Brazil telecom market is projected to exhibit a growth rate (CAGR) of 5.64% during 2024-2032.

Latin America Telecommunication Infrastructure Market News:

  • In August 2024, Nokia collaborated with Claro Argentina to complete the initial phase of 5G network rollout in the nation, targeting Argentina's major cities and aiding Claro's mission to digitize the country with dependable, low-latency, and ultra-fast connectivity for both individuals and businesses.
  • In September 2024, Ikue, a leading provider of Customer Data Platforms (CDP) for telecommunications operators, partnered with IEC Partners to expand into the North American and Latin American markets and make a significant impact in the dynamic and fast-growing telecom sectors across the Americas.
